    Golden State Warriors guard Moses Moody had one of the best nights of his career on Sunday. The Warriors had a 124-106 win over the New Orleans Pelicans, with significant help from Moody, who had a career-high of 32 points. Most of it came from the first quarter, when he had a career-best seven made 3-pointers. The 2021 first-round pick had 21 points in the opening quarter, which set the tone for the rest of the game.

    Moody had his fifth start of the year, and it was significantly beneficial for the team. On Friday, Moody was part of the starting lineup, but he struggled on the floor. The former Arkansas guard only had four points on four-for-eight shooting against the San Antonio Spurs. Fortunately for Golden State, they secured a 109-108 win against the Victor Wembanyama-led team.

    The guard performed better this time around with his hot shooting from deep.

    There have been several trade rumors regarding Anthony Davis after the Dallas Mavericks fired general manager Nico Harrison. Many believe that the All-Star big man could be on the move next. His injuries have not impacted the Mavericks positively, as he’s missed eight straight games this season. According to ESPN’s Shams Charania, Davis could miss at least seven to 10 more games.

    Amid the trade talks, CBS Sports’ Sam Quinn suggested that the Warriors could be the ideal destination for Davis.

    “The fit is pretty straightforward,” Quinn wrote. “Davis is the rim-protector and lob catcher the Warriors have wanted forever. They would’ve been thrilled if James Wiseman had been half of the player Anthony Davis is. He can play in their switch-y defense. He’s a capable enough ball-handler and passer to function in Golden State’s unconventional offense. He’d be Stephen Curry’s best teammate since Kevin Durant. This is the team that can look at Davis and say “getting him might be the difference between a championship or bust.”

    With Davis’ injury history, however, Golden State might be hesitant to trade for the star big man.
